Realize band...first fill...how much...

I have the Realize band and I'm getting my first fill soon - just curious, how much did they put in for your first fill? I have no idea what he was planning to do but like I said, was curious. Did you notice restriction with the first fill? I have slight restriction now. When I say slight I mean that I could still eat a fairly large amount of food if I wanted to. Not quite what I could eat before but certainly more than the 1/2 - 1 cup of food.

Do you go to the realized band website? I have the same band and I read there alot, they give you info for their band. Dr. schram did mine and I got for the first fill was 2cc I have had 4 fills thus far for a total of 6.5cc's which he says is the spot for most. I can tell you that I felt the restriction by the 3rd fill. I would go the the website for more info if you need.

I have 2.5cc in a my realize, and I've got pretty good restriction. This is my first fill, and I got it a little while ago, but I met a woman in the waiting room of the doctor's office who had 5cc in her first fill (my doctor does all fills under fluoroscopy).

My first fill was 3.8cc's, 2nd was 3cc's. I have pretty good restriction now but I think I want just a touch more because I am starting to get hungry after 2 or 3 hours if I stick to the 1/2 cup of food that my Dr. recommends. Dr's seem to fill a bit more aggressively if it is done under flouro.

I have the Realize band and was told that the first fill (mine will be next week on 5/21) will be 4cc, as that is the standard for the first one with this band.

The surgeon said that it should be sufficient for the most part and that if, at all, I should only need 2, maybe 3 more slight fills for my lifetime afterward.

My doc said she does no more than 3 or 4 cc for the first fill depending on the patient's restriction level. Mine was "none" so I got 4 cc. I felt nothing for 3 weeks, then suddenly a bit of restriction! It went away again though. I'm going this week for another fill; I'll see how much she's willing to do for a second one.

I was banded March 28 and had my first fill on April 28. The nurse practitioner, who does all of the fills for the practice, gave me 3 cc without fluro. I have no restriction and can eat anything, unfortunately. My second fill was scheduled for June 2 but I called and moved it up to May 19th. Can't wait although my first fill was very uncomfortable. I was the 4th Realize Band the doctor had placed. My nurse said they are trickier to fill because they are a lower profile than Lap Bands and are harder to find. She had to dig around a little bit...OUCH !!!

My surgeon gave me the booklet that came with the band that includes the instructions for the surgery and fills. The booklet recommends 4cc for the first fill, which is what I got.

I have 7.5 cc now and am going back in a couple of days for another fill, probably a small one.

I had my first fill today and I have the Realize band..... My doctor put in 2cc's.... She tried to put 3 but that was too much for me. I was told that the usual for the first fill is around 4cc's. It all depends on the person... some people still have good restriction when they go for their first fill.
